Yeoman work in theater and independent releases brought him to the attention of Steven Spielberg, who cast him in pivotal roles in both his HBO production "Band of Brothers" (2001) and "Minority Report" (2002). The exposure gained him a foothold in Hollywood, where he impressed on both the small screen with "Boomtown" (NBC, 2002-03) and in theaters with Clint Eastwood's "Flags of Our Fathers" (2005).
